CSA warns public against unapproved digital lending money apps

The Cyber Security Authority (CSA) has issued a warning to the public against using digital lending mobile applications (Apps) due to a rise in cyberbullying cases among users.

In a press release, the CSA reported receiving approximately 130 complaints from victims who had used these apps, which are not approved by the Bank of Ghana or the Data Protection Commission.

The CSA identified several problematic loan apps, including Ahomka Loan, Antcredit, Beanloan, Bestloan, BezoMoney, Boomloan, Casharrow, Cashwave, Cmgh Loan, Cosycredit, Credit Bag, Divacash, Express Loan, Five Loan, FullCredit, Homecredit, Unik Credit, Ozzy Money, Pea Money, Roseloan, Safeloan among others.

The authority noted that the operations of these loan apps violate the Banks and Specialised Deposit-Taking Institutions Act, 2016 (Act 930), as stated in Bank of Ghana (BoG) notice BG/GOV/SEC/2022/10.

The CSA urged the public to avoid these apps and to report any cybersecurity or cybercrime incidents to the Authority via text or call 292, email- report@csa.gov.gh and WhatsApp number 050160311.
